Beginning in 2009 when he was 77 years old and continuing until June 2012 at age 80 veteran rights activist Julian Heicklen was confronted, harassed, attacked, arrested and jailed by the very law enforcers and justice officials charged with protecting his rights. On more than one occasion He was injected with dangerous antipsychotic drugs, all because he refused to be complicit in his own illegal arrests.

His "crime" was giving jury rights pamphlets to fellow citizens on public sidewalks in front of America's public courthouses. Over the years his supporters – Tyranny Fighters – assisted him in whatever capacity they could; helping distribute brochures, video recording, photographing, witnessing, publicizing, interviewing, advocating and aiding in his legal battles.

My own role as a Tyranny Fighter was reporter, writer, opinionizer, publicist and advocate with my online column "The Libertarian News Examiner." Julian was fond of saying "The price of justice is eternal publicity" and I took on that role as my personal challenge.
